Inspector, known in Japan as SP inspector,[a] is an enemy fought in Paella and Sugarleaf Plains West on Razen in Magical Starsign.

Profile

Inspectors appear similar to other members of the Space Police, but wear black uniforms and wield a trumpet for combat.

Enemy

Despite having light affinity, inspectors do not possess any spells affected by aura. They can perform the neutral spell celestial swap, allowing them to change the alignment of planets to their advantage. They have the physical skill bomb launcher, dealing damage to every member of the party. Using the skill reformation, they can move other enemies to different rows; this allows Sr. Patrolmen to perform punishing bomb from the back row. They take slightly less damage from both physical and magic attacks.[1][2]

Bestiary entry

The chief inspector of the Space Police wastes no time on investigations. He keeps himself free for more important things, like throwing bombs at civilians.
